Intuit up Nearly 7%, on Pace for Largest Percent Increase Since May 2025

Dow Jones01:17

Intuit Inc. $(INTU)$ is currently at $293.66, up $18.70 or 6.8%

 

--Would be highest close since June 9, 2026, when it closed at $293.78

--On pace for largest percent increase since May 23, 2025, when it rose 8.12%

--Currently up four of the past five days

--Currently up three consecutive days; up 7.92% over this period

--Best three day stretch since the three days ending June 1, 2026, when it rose 14.96%

--Up 12.51% month-to-date

--Down 55.67% year-to-date

--Down 63.63% from its all-time closing high of $807.39 on July 30, 2025

--Down 60.99% from 52 weeks ago (July 14, 2025), when it closed at $752.75

--Down 63.63% from its 52-week closing high of $807.39 on July 30, 2025

--Up 15.13% from its 52-week closing low of $255.07 on June 25, 2026

--Traded as high as $294.80; highest intraday level since June 9, 2026, when it hit $308.74

--Up 7.22% at today's intraday high; largest intraday percent increase since June 1, 2026, when it rose as much as 9.55%

--Best performer in the S&P 500 today

--Best performer in the Nasdaq 100 today

 

All data as of 1:14:47 PM ET

 

Source: Dow Jones Market Data, FactSet
